Set Up eSIM on iOS

*
Here’s how to set up a local eSIM on your iOS device, when you arrive at your destination.

1. Open the Camera app and Scan the eSIM QR code.
2. Click Continue button.

Important Notes.
You can recharge only after passport verification is completed.
Operating hours: 00:00 to 24:00.
Outgoing charges are automatically deducted from your balance.
Extension of eSIM usage period is not allowed.
Unused balance will expire at the end of the validity period.
When your balance runs out, you can’t send voice/text, but you can still receive data and voice/text.
When your balance runs out, you can send voice/text again after recharging.
The maximum charge is KRW 330,000.
Call, and SMS products can be canceled or refunded on the same day if not used.
